Karapınar solar power plant

Karapınar Solar Power Plant (Turkish: Karapınar Güneş Enerjisi Santrali) is a photovoltaic power station in Konya Province, central Turkey.. Built in the Renewable Energy Resource Area (YEKA) in Karapınar district in Konya Province, the plant has 1,300 MW installed power and covers an area of 20 square kilometres (7.7 sq mi). Türkiye Electricity Review 2023

The energy plan projects that solar reaches almost 53 GW by 2035, up from 9.4 GW in 2022. With this increase, solar power is expected to have the largest installed capacity among all generation sources in Türkiye. This would put solar generating 16.5% of Türkiye''s power in 2035, up from 4.7% in 2022.

Can Türkiye utilise its rooftop solar potential?

Türkiye can utilise its rooftop solar potential to catch up with installation rates in EU countries and get on track to meet its clean energy targets. Rooftops in Türkiye have a technical potential of 120 GW and can meet 45% of the country’s total electricity demand.

How much solar power will Türkiye have in 2035?

Although Türkiye has added 11 GW of wind and solar capacity in the last five years, other European countries have proved this is possible in a single year. According to the NEP, solar energy capacity is set to reach 52 GW in 2035. To meet this target, an annual average of 3.4 GW of new solar capacity is foreseen to be added.
